I have installed AutoGK 2.48b.I had a DVD having a runtime of 184 minutes.As quality was what i wanted,i decided to go for a 3cd rip using autogk's 'predefined size' option.Now the problem i am having is that autogk produced 3 output files , 2 avi's of 700mb each(splitted around 1.5 hrs each) and produced the 3rd avi of around 5-6 mins of around 60 megs.
Any idea how to produce three 700 meg files of approx. equal duration using autogk or any other software?

Using a bitrate calculator and 3 CDs size (2100MB) gives you about 1350kbps bitrate. Set your encoder to that and split the output into three parts. That's with 224kbps audio. This from the VideoHelp Bitrate calculator.
